When a patriotic effect is desired the flag may be ... cult brewery stevensville mdWebFor flag patches worn on uniforms, the same principle applies: the blue star field always faces towards the front, with the red and white stripes behind. Think of the flag, not as a patch, but as a loose flag attached to the Soldier's arm like a flag pole.
